    My original appointment was already unpleasant because the staff were rude and condescending, which…read moreis why I decided I would never return. Unfortunately, my recent experience trying to obtain my own contact-lens prescription confirmed that decision. I called only to learn the brand and prescription information for the contacts I previously wore. After verifying my identity and account information, the employee refused to provide it over the phone and said I had to register for their patient portal. I explained that I intentionally do not use their portal and requested the prescription by email instead. The manager then became argumentative, insisted I was wrong, and claimed HIPAA requires the email to be encrypted. That is not accurate. HHS explicitly states that patients may request their health information by unencrypted email after being warned of and accepting the security risk. The FTC also states that an eye-care provider cannot use HIPAA as a barrier to electronically providing a prescription. I would have gladly verified my identity, signed a request, or acknowledged the risks of ordinary email. Instead, management spoke to me condescendingly, gave me inaccurate information about my legal rights, and attempted to force me into a portal I never agreed to use. I will not return and will be filing complaints with the appropriate agencies regarding access to my prescription.
